Georgia Firm Recalls Ground Beef Over E. Coli Contamination
K2D, a Carlton, Georgia-based company doing business as Colorado Premium Foods, is recalling more than 113,000 pounds of ground beef products over concerns of potential E. coli contamination, the USDA Food Safety Inspection Service (FSIS) reported on Tuesday.

Target Recalls 500,000 Wooden Toys Over Choking Hazard
Target Corp. is recalling Bullseye’s Playground wooden toy vehicles over concerns that the items may pose a choking risk to children, the U.S. Consumer Products Safety Commission (CPSC) announced on Thursday.

Ben & Jerry’s Recalls 2 Flavors Ice Cream Over Undeclared Nuts
Unilever, the company that owns Ben & Jerry's, has issued a nationwide recall for 2 flavors of ice cream amid reports of undeclared nuts in some of the packages, according to CNN.
